PHX Energy Services Corporation is seeing a boost in its stock price, reflecting positive market sentiment.

PHX Energy Services Corporation (PHX.TO) is up today, gaining 2.06% to close at CA$12.37. This increase comes as a result of solid operational performance and strategic positioning within the energy sector.

Methodology: Range is calculated using 30-day realized volatility via geometric Brownian motion (log-normal model). 68% band = ±1σ, 95% band = ±2σ. This is a statistical model, not a prediction. Past volatility does not guarantee future results. Not financial advice.
